The Irish Celtic music scene is a vibrant and diverse community that celebrates the rich musical traditions of Ireland and Celtic cultures.
Key Features
- Traditional Irish instruments such as the fiddle, tin whistle, bodhran, and uilleann pipes
- Incorporation of elements from Celtic folklore and mythology
- Lively jigs, reels, and ballads that evoke a sense of nostalgia and storytelling
